True When the null hypothesis is rejected in an ANOVA test, Fisher's least significant difference method is superior to Tukey's honestly significant differences … WebJul 10, 2014 · This reasoning for four groups is a generalization from Fisher's explanation for his three-group Least Significant Difference method. For N groups, the correction factor, if the omnibus Anova test is significant, is (N-1)(N-2)/2. So the Bonferroni correction, by a factor of N(N-1)/2, is too strong.

WebApr 23, 2024 · You do a Fisher's exact test on each of the 6 possible pairwise comparisons (daily vs. weekly, daily vs. monthly, etc.), then apply the Bonferroni correction for multiple tests.
